暗号資産(仮想通貨)の技術的な基礎知識解説



暗号資産(仮想通貨)の技術的な基礎知識解説


暗号資産(仮想通貨)の技術的な基礎知識解説

はじめに

暗号資産(仮想通貨)は、デジタルまたは仮想的な通貨であり、暗号技術を用いて取引の安全性を確保しています。近年、その存在感を増しており、金融システムに新たな可能性をもたらす一方で、技術的な理解が不可欠となっています。本稿では、暗号資産の技術的な基礎知識について、専門的な視点から詳細に解説します。

1. 暗号資産の起源と背景

暗号資産の概念は、1980年代にデービッド・チャウムによって提唱された暗号プライバシー技術に遡ります。しかし、実用的な暗号資産として最初に登場したのは、2008年にサトシ・ナカモトによって発表されたビットコインです。ビットコインは、中央銀行などの仲介者を介さずに、P2P(ピアツーピア)ネットワーク上で直接取引を行うことを可能にしました。これは、従来の金融システムにおける課題、例えば取引コストの高さや検閲のリスクなどを克服する可能性を秘めていました。

暗号資産の背景には、暗号技術の発展、分散型ネットワークの実現可能性、そして金融システムの変革への期待などが存在します。特に、公開鍵暗号方式とハッシュ関数は、暗号資産のセキュリティを支える重要な技術基盤となっています。

2. ブロックチェーン技術の基礎

暗号資産の中核となる技術は、ブロックチェーンです。ブロックチェーンは、取引履歴を記録したブロックを鎖のように連結した分散型台帳です。各ブロックには、複数の取引データ、前のブロックへのハッシュ値、そしてタイムスタンプが含まれています。

2.1 ブロックの構造

ブロックは、主に以下の要素で構成されます。

* **ブロックヘッダー:** ブロックのメタデータ(バージョン、前のブロックのハッシュ値、タイムスタンプ、ナンスなど)が含まれます。
* **トランザクションデータ:** 実際に取引された内容(送信者アドレス、受信者アドレス、送金額など)が含まれます。
* **ハッシュ値:** ブロックの内容を要約した固定長の文字列です。ブロックの内容が少しでも変更されると、ハッシュ値も変化します。

2.2 分散型台帳の仕組み

ブロックチェーンは、ネットワークに参加する複数のノードによって共有されます。各ノードは、ブロックチェーンのコピーを保持し、新しい取引を検証し、ブロックを生成する役割を担います。新しいブロックが生成されると、ネットワーク全体にブロードキャストされ、他のノードによって検証されます。検証が完了すると、ブロックはブロックチェーンに追加され、ネットワーク全体で共有されます。

2.3 コンセンサスアルゴリズム

ブロックチェーンの整合性を維持するためには、コンセンサスアルゴリズムが必要です。コンセンサスアルゴリズムは、ネットワーク参加者間で合意を形成するためのルールです。代表的なコンセンサスアルゴリズムには、PoW(Proof of Work)、PoS(Proof of Stake)などがあります。

* **PoW:** 計算問題を解くことでブロックを生成する権利を得るアルゴリズムです。ビットコインで採用されています。
* **PoS:** 仮想通貨の保有量に応じてブロックを生成する権利を得るアルゴリズムです。イーサリアム2.0で採用されています。

3. 暗号技術の応用

暗号資産のセキュリティは、様々な暗号技術によって支えられています。

3.1 公開鍵暗号方式

公開鍵暗号方式は、暗号化と復号に異なる鍵を使用する暗号技術です。公開鍵は誰でも入手できますが、復号鍵は秘密に保持されます。これにより、安全な通信やデジタル署名が可能になります。暗号資産では、公開鍵がアドレスとして使用され、秘密鍵が取引の署名に使用されます。

3.2 ハッシュ関数

ハッシュ関数は、任意の長さのデータを固定長の文字列に変換する関数です。ハッシュ関数は、一方向性(元のデータをハッシュ値から復元することが困難)と衝突耐性(異なるデータが同じハッシュ値になることが困難)という特性を持ちます。ブロックチェーンでは、ハッシュ関数がブロックの整合性を検証するために使用されます。

3.3 デジタル署名

デジタル署名は、電子文書の作成者を認証し、改ざんを検知するための技術です。暗号資産では、秘密鍵を用いて取引にデジタル署名することで、取引の正当性を保証します。

4. 主要な暗号資産の種類

暗号資産には、様々な種類が存在します。それぞれの暗号資産は、異なる目的や技術的な特徴を持っています。

4.1 ビットコイン (BTC)

ビットコインは、最初の暗号資産であり、最も広く知られています。ビットコインは、P2Pネットワーク上で直接取引を行うことを可能にし、中央銀行などの仲介者を介さずに価値を交換することができます。

4.2 イーサリアム (ETH)

イーサリアムは、スマートコントラクトと呼ばれるプログラムを実行できるプラットフォームです。スマートコントラクトは、特定の条件が満たされた場合に自動的に実行される契約です。イーサリアムは、DeFi(分散型金融)やNFT(非代替性トークン)などの分野で広く利用されています。

4.3 リップル (XRP)

リップルは、銀行間の国際送金を効率化するためのプラットフォームです。リップルは、高速かつ低コストな送金を実現することを目指しています。

4.4 ライトコイン (LTC)

ライトコインは、ビットコインの改良版として開発されました。ライトコインは、ビットコインよりも高速な取引処理速度と低い取引手数料を実現しています。

5. 暗号資産の課題と今後の展望

暗号資産は、多くの可能性を秘めている一方で、いくつかの課題も抱えています。

5.1 スケーラビリティ問題

ブロックチェーンの処理能力には限界があり、取引量が増加すると処理速度が低下する可能性があります。この問題を解決するために、レイヤー2ソリューションやシャーディングなどの技術が開発されています。

5.2 セキュリティリスク

暗号資産は、ハッキングや詐欺などのセキュリティリスクにさらされています。セキュリティ対策を強化するために、ウォレットのセキュリティ管理やスマートコントラクトの監査などが重要です。

5.3 法規制の未整備

暗号資産に関する法規制は、まだ整備途上にあります。法規制の整備が進むことで、暗号資産の普及が促進される可能性があります。

今後の展望としては、暗号資産の技術的な進化、DeFiやNFTなどの新たなアプリケーションの登場、そして法規制の整備などが期待されます。暗号資産は、金融システムに大きな変革をもたらす可能性を秘めており、その動向から目が離せません。

まとめ

本稿では、暗号資産の技術的な基礎知識について詳細に解説しました。暗号資産は、ブロックチェーン技術と暗号技術を基盤としており、従来の金融システムにおける課題を克服する可能性を秘めています。しかし、スケーラビリティ問題やセキュリティリスクなどの課題も存在します。今後の技術的な進化や法規制の整備によって、暗号資産はより広く普及し、金融システムに大きな変革をもたらすことが期待されます。


前の記事

暗号資産(仮想通貨)の税務申告金額計算方法

次の記事

ビットコインETFとは?初心者向けわかりやすく解説!

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です